Editorial Reviews

From School Library Journal
PreSchool-Grade 2-In a kinetic and goofy rhyming story, various denizens of the dinosaur world gather to join in a noisy, wild dance. This is another successful read-stamp-shout-giggle-sing-aloud from the author-illustrator duo who created Down by the Cool of the Pool (Orchard, 2002). This title shares with its predecessor an ever-increasing frenzy until the final few pages, when the "rompers drift together/and tumble in a heap-/`til finally the dinosaurs/are all fast asleep." From the swoop and "Eeeeeek!" of the pteranodon and the tail-thumping "Thwack! Thwack! Thwack!" of the brontosaurus (kids will no doubt offer its proper name) to the high-kicking "Stomp! Stomp! Stomp!" of the T. rex, each animal presents a fine opportunity for vocal and physical silliness that will be welcome wherever blood-stirring activity is needed. The colorful, eye-popping illustrations are sure to entice, and the recurring appearance of two small furry mammalians, while inaccurate from a natural history standpoint, provide a wry counterpoint to the action. A caveat for read-alouds: many of these names-deinosuchus, deinonychuses, and even styracosaurus-will not trip off the tongue without a fair amount of practice.
Dona Ratterree, New York City Public Schools

From Booklist
PreS. "Shake, shake, shudder . . . near the sludgy old swamp. The dinosaurs are coming. Get ready to romp." A neon-bright Brontosaurus, a dancing Deinosuchus, and other raucous dinos gather at the swamp for a wild, earth-pounding party in this exuberant picture book. Mitton's gleeful rhymes introduce dinosaur species as they rumble and boogie across the spreads in irresistible, color-saturated cartoonlike artwork that shows the humor and farce of the giant beasts shaking their scales and tails. The book ends with a nighttime scene of sleeping dinosaurs that's perfect for bedtime reading: "Now the only noise in the deep of the night is dinosaur-snoring 'til the next day's light." It's sure to be a big hit at story hours, too; expect young listeners to jump up and add their own wriggles and shakes to the dinosaur party. Gillian Engberg

My 3 year old loves dinosaurs, so I bought this book without really looking at it. I am so glad that I did, because it has become our favorite book -- and NOT because of the dinosaurs. My son loves hearing the rhymes and the repetitions (like an advanced "Brown Bear, Brown Bear") and often repeats them with me. He also quotes the silly rhymes as he plays with other toys. At night, we act out the story and he has quite a "rumpus" before settling down to sleep. All in all, a cute fun book that any child will adore and one that parents will like as it teaches rhymes and sounds of words in a fun way.
